With more than 120 operations and approximately 20,000 employees worldwide, Precision Castparts Corp. is the market leader in manufacturing large, complex structural investment castings, airfoil castings, forged components, aerostructures and highly engineered, critical fasteners for aerospace applications. In addition, we are the leading producer of airfoil castings for the industrial gas turbine market. We also manufacture extruded seamless pipe, fittings, and forgings for power generation and oil & gas applications; commercial and military airframe aerostructures; and metal alloys and other materials for the casting and forging industries. With such critical applications, we insist on quality and dependability – not just in the materials and products we make, but in the people we recruit.

PCC is relentless in its dedication to being a high-quality, low-cost and on-time producer; delivering the highest value to its customers while continually pursuing strategic, profitable growth.

In 2016, Berkshire Hathaway, led by Chairman and CEO Warren E. Buffett, acquired Precision Castparts Corp.

Summary

Reporting to the Quality Manger, this position is responsible for the leadership of laboratory technicians, management of the laboratory quality systems and equipment and the certification of finished product.

Essential Functions

  • Responsible and accountable for implementing, enforcing, and promoting safety and 6S initiatives and expectations.
  • Supervises, directs, and evaluates the job performance of lab technicians.
  • Develops, coaches, and trains employees in technical work instructions, job procedures and other subjects in accordance with job training requirements.
  • Review employee time and attendance, assign appropriate time codes, and approve vacation requests.
  • Responsible and accountable for adhering and enforcing policies defined in the Handbook.
  • Prioritize and schedule analytical testing required prior to shipping finished goods.
  • Communicate results of analyses in a timely and professional manner, including reports, papers/publications, and presentations.
  • Maintain the C-M metallurgical laboratory including equipment upgrades, calibrations, preventative maintenance, and unscheduled service.
  • Administer and maintain Laboratory Information Management System (LIMS) in C-M Laboratories.
  • Review and issue finished good certifications.
  • Manage and maintain laboratory certifications including management of technical documentation, coordination of round-robin testing, and maintaining lab technician certifications.
  • Utilize LIMs to develop and implement process control plans relevant to laboratory analysis.
  • Maintain proper overtime list(s).
  • Responsible for tracking and supporting cost reduction efforts.
  • All other duties as assigned.

      This position requires use of information or access to production processes subject to national security controls under U.S. export control laws and regulations (including, but not limited to the International Traffic in Arms Regulations (ITAR) and the Export Administration Regulations (EAR)). To be qualified to work in this facility, a successful applicant must be a U.S. Person, as defined in those regulations, and able to supply evidence of that qualification prior to starting work or be authorized to receive controlled information under a specific license or permission from the relevant government agency. The U.S. export control regulations define a U.S. person as a U.S. Citizen, U.S. National, U.S. Permanent Resident (i.e. &39;Green Card Holder&39;), and certain categories of Asylees and Refugees.
